Rainer Nõlvak is an Estonian entrepreneur and nature protector who is Chairman of the board of Estonian Nature Fund. Rainer Nõlvak has advocated for the Estonian energy industry to move away from oil shale and move towards renewable energy systems. He has published the "Green Energy" program. He was among the organizers of Let's Do It 2008, a civic action with 50 000 volunteers participating in cleaning up the countriside of Estonia in one day. Because of this he received the 2008 Estonian Volunteer of the Year national award. The movement has initiated the global Let's Do It! World action.
